Consumer Packaged Goods Market Summary
As per Market Research Future analysis, the Consumer Packaged Goods Market was estimated at 3450 USD Billion in 2024. The Consumer Packaged Goods industry is projected to grow from 3602.5 USD Billion in 2025 to 5551.9 USD Billion by 2035, exhibiting a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 4.4% during the forecast period 2025 - 2035. North America holds the largest share of the global Consumer Packaged Goods Market at approximately 35%, driven by robust demand for health and wellness products, strong consumer purchasing power, and a highly developed retail ecosystem. The United States is the leading country within North America, capturing approximately 28% of the global Consumer Packaged Goods Market share, anchored by powerhouse companies like Procter & Gamble, PepsiCo, Coca-Cola, and Nestlé USA across food, beverage, and personal care segments. Food & Beverages dominate the Consumer Packaged Goods Market as the largest product segment, accounting for an estimated 43% of the global market share in 2025, driven by consistent consumer demand for convenience foods, health-focused options, and sustainable packaging innovations.
